DTRA Atomic Veterans Commemorative Service Medal 9-13-23 Awards Ceremony

21 Atomic Veterans were invited to attend the private ceremony at Fort Belvoir Virginia.

19 Atomic Test Era Veterans and 6 Atomic Cleanup Mission Veterans attended. 6 were unable to attend.

The ceremony included key DTRA staff personnel, Ms. Rebecca Hersman, Director of DTRA, Honorable James McGovern, U.S. House of Representatives, Massachusetts 2nd Congressional District, Atomic Veterans, Family Members and Guests.
